Done my weekly shopping yesterday, went to the checkout, put my card in the keypad, entered my number and was told by the checkout girl it wouldn't take my card and to do it, so I took the card out and put it in again entered the pin number and this time it accepted it.
Last night I went onto my internet banking and saw 2 transactions for the same amount, so it did take first time.
I went back to tescos today with my receipt, told the manager what had happened and now they want a bank statement, a mini statement from the cashpoint isn't good enough, so now I've got to go to my bank tomorrow get a statement and then go back to tescos again. Problem is I don't think the transactions will show on the statement as being from tescos, until probably Tuesday.
Wouldn't mind if I got an apology, didn't get anything from them today, for their own stupid mistake.

It's unlikely both transactions will actually come out it sounds like pre-authorised amounts.
The tills are made so that transactions can't go through more than once.0 -
